In my current fort, my militia commander and the chief medical dwarf are lovers.  When the militia commander was injured in the latest siege, it was the chief medic who came to carry her to the hospital.  Seeing this, I pictured him watching the fighting and seeing his beloved fall with an arrow in her leg, and rushing out, determined to rescue her.  It was one of those awesome, heartwarming moments that DF generates so well.  Describing the event to a friend who recently started playing DF, I quoted from the militia commander's thought screen: "Adil Bekarcerol has been ecstatic lately.  She was rescued recently."  We both agreed that it would be a nice touch if the 'rescued' thought was modified when the rescuer was a friend or relative, much like the 'haunted by the dead' thought.  Just a little change to highlight these epic moments.
